Jade Tang-Taylor

Kaiwhakahaere Matua | Director
New Zealand

Jade brings a wide range of experience of Design & Social Innovation space in Aotearoa New Zealand. As a Strategic Designer, Facilitator, Innovator, Collaborator & Educator, Jade is deeply passionate about Co-Designing Better Futures. Jade is a firm believer in tangata tiriti meaningfully partnering with tangata whenua, and collaborating with diverse people of lived experience to co-create innovative solutions with those most impacted.

Jade’s career has been more of a squiggly line, than a straight line. Prior to joining ThinkPlace, Jade worked on a myriad of game-changing projects with change-making organisations. She was most recently Innovation Director at AcademyEX | Tech Futures Lab, has been part of the leadership team at Foundation North, an associate at the Centre for Social Impact, Toi Āria & Innovation Unit, co-founder of the social change creative agency Curative, and co-host of CreativeMornings/AKL chapter.

Jade is a lifelong learner, she’s currently curious around the intersection of Design Thinking, Systems Thinking & Futures Thinking. She holds a Masters of Arts Management from AUT University, with distinction and most recently embarked on a Designing for Social Systems masterclass at Stanford D. School. 

Alongside being a Fractional Leader / Director at ThinkPlace, as part of her portfolio, Jade’s other hats include: Industry Advisor at AcademyEX, Co-Founder of Speculative Design Futures chapter in Tāmaki Makaurau AKL, and holds a couple of governance roles, as well as being a proud working mum of one, and a lover of cheese.
